Bum-Jin Lee is a scholar working on Pathology and Forensic Medicine, Food Science and Molecular Biology. According to data from OpenAlex, Bum-Jin Lee has authored 8 papers receiving a total of 497 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Pathology and Forensic Medicine, 4 papers in Food Science and 3 papers in Molecular Biology. Recurrent topics in Bum-Jin Lee's work include Tea Polyphenols and Effects (6 papers), Food Quality and Safety Studies (4 papers) and Metabolomics and Mass Spectrometry Studies (3 papers). Bum-Jin Lee is often cited by papers focused on Tea Polyphenols and Effects (6 papers), Food Quality and Safety Studies (4 papers) and Metabolomics and Mass Spectrometry Studies (3 papers). Bum-Jin Lee collaborates with scholars based in South Korea. Bum-Jin Lee's co-authors include Jin‐Oh Chung, Young‐Shick Hong, Jang‐Eun Lee, Sang Jun Lee, Cherl‐Ho Lee, Eun‐Hee Kim, Hyosang Lee, Hyun‐Jung Shin, Sang-Jun Lee and Sangjun Lee and has published in prestigious journals such as The Journal of Immunology, Journal of Agricultural and Food Chemistry and Food Chemistry.
